Lit Hub's Most Anticipated Books of 2022, Part Two - Page 2

"Halfway through, and 2022 is looking like another bad year. (That is, if you care about reproductive health and bodily autonomy, the environment, global peace, affordable living, sane public health policies, not being gunned down in a school, supermarket, or literally anywhere, and/or the future of democracy itself.)
But you're not here to think about any of that. You're here because you've already read all the best new books from the first half of the year and you're ready for more. (Right? Right.) For our second Big Preview of the year, we've picked out the 230 books being published between July and December that we're most looking forward to. No matter what kind of a reader you are, or what kind of a year we're having, you're sure to find something to interest you here."
